Any results that are reported to constitute a blinded, independent validation of a statistical model (or mathematical classifier or predictor) must be accompanied by a detailed explanation that includes: 1) specification of the exact «locked down» form of the model, including all data processing steps, algorithm for calculating the model output, and any cutpoints that might be applied to the model output for final classification, 2) date on which the model or predictor was fully locked down in exactly the form described, 3) name of the individual (s) who maintained the blinded data and oversaw the evaluation (e.g., honest broker), 4) statement of assurance that no modifications, additions, or exclusion were made to the validation data set from the point at which the model was locked down and that neither the validation data nor any subset of it had ever been used to assess or refine the model being tested
They also used tenfold cross validation to train the models for responsiveness, and then tested these on the validation samples as well.
The researchers also tested their prediction models on the validation set, and this resulted in ROC (receiver operating characteristic) plot points with an AUC (area under the curve) of 91.6 percent for general responsiveness, 89.7 percent for TNFi response and 85.7 percent for rituximab response.
They used 70 percent of the samples to develop response prediction models, and reserved 30 percent for validation.
